Description

CoraFluor(TM) 1 is a high performance terbium-based TR-FRET (Time-Resolved Fluorescence Resonance Energy Transfer) or TRF (Time-Resolved Fluorescence) donor for high throughput assay development. CoraFluor(TM) 1 absorbs UV light at approximately 340 nm, and emits at approximately 490 nm, 545 nm, 585 nm and 620 nm. It is compatible with common acceptor dyes that absorb at the emission wavelengths of CoraFluor(TM) 1. CoraFluor(TM) 1 can be used for the development of robust and scalable TR-FRET binding assays such as target engagement, ternary complex, protein-protein interaction and protein quantification assays.

Product Feature: CoraFluor Probes for TR-FRET

CoraFluor™ 1, amine reactive (Catalog:7920) and CoraFluor™ 2, amine reactive (Catalog # 7950) are terbium-based probes that have been developed for use as TR-FRET donors. They emit wavelengths compatible with commonly used fluorescent acceptor dyes such as BODIPY® (or BDY) and Janelia Fluor® dyes, FITC (Catalog # 5440), TMR and Cyanine 5 (Catalog # 5436). CoraFluor™ fluorescence is brighter and more stable in biological media than existing TR-FRET donors, leading to enhanced sensitivity and improved data generation. CoraFluor™ 1 exhibits excitation upon exposure to a 337 nm UV laser.

Background: ITM2C

ITM2C also known as Integral membrane protein 2C, has 3 isoforms, an isoform 1that is 267 amino acid and 30 kDa, an isoform 2 that is 220 amino acid and 25 kDa, and an isoform 3 that is 230 amino acid and 26 kDa; most commonly found in the brain tissue; acts as negative regulator of beta amyloid peptide production, may inhibit the processing of APP by blocking its access to alpha- and beta-secretase, appears to be a poor gamma-secretase cleavage inhibitor, and may play a role in TNF-induced cell death and neuronal differentiation. Studies are being performed on the relationship of this protein to anemia of prematurity, cerebritis, anemia, dementia, influenza, gastric cancer, and neuronitis. The protein has been shown to interact with BACE1, APP, STMN2, STT3A, RNF7, and FURIN proteins in negative regulation of neuron projection development, induction of programmed cell death, and neuron differentiation pathways.
